Creative embroidery: giving shape to what balances us
With the Creative Embroidery Workshop, led by our Gamer Catarina Menezes, the challenge was simple: choose a word that symbolized balance and well-being and transform it into a personalized piece.
More than learning a technique, this moment was about slowing down, reflecting, and discovering how the act of creating can be a form of self-care. Each stitch of thread represented a reminder that mindfulness is also built through simple gestures.

Autumn crochet: creativity with purpose
In the Crochet Workshop led by our Gamer Maria Duarte, participants created autumn-inspired coasters and candle covers. These pieces, in addition to their practical utility, carried a clear message: breaks can also be productive moments.
Without the need for previous experience, this activity was an opportunity to experiment, learn, and rediscover the pleasure of making something with one's own hands, away from screens, stimulating other dimensions of our brain and creativity.
